Pattinson Estate Agents welcome to the sales market this modern three bedroom detached house situated on Montgomerie Court within the popular Seaton Vale development in Ashington. Ideally located for access to local primary and secondary schools with a local Tesco Express on site and just a short walk into the town centre with an array of shops, supermarkets, leisure facilities and travel links including the new train station linking directly into Newcastle city centre. Newbiggin By The Sea sits just two miles to the east and Morpeth five miles to the west.

This lovely family home benefits from Upvc double glazing, upgraded kitchen and recently fitted gas combi boiler. Sold with no upper chain, early viewings are essential to avoid disappointment.

Briefly comprising; entrance porch, lounge, inner hallway, cloakroom and kitchen/diner. To the first floor master bedroom with fitted wardrobes and en-suite shower room, two further double bedrooms and family bathroom. Externally to the front an open plan lawn with driveway leading to the integral single garage. To the rear a pleasant enclosed garden laid with astro turf for easy maintenance.
